WebThe Port of Prince Rupert is located on the scenic North Coast of British Columbia. As Canada’s second-largest West Coast port, the Port is strategically situated on the Pacific Rim, with the deepest natural harbour in North America and direct connections to the North American continent by CN Rail’s network reach.

Here are detailed driving instructions from Highway 16, the main highway: WebPrince Rupert is located on Kaien Island, just off the northwest coast of BC and at the western end of Yellowhead Highway 16. It is approximately 48 km (30 mi) south of Alaska and 145 km (90 mi) west of Terrace. The small community of Port Edward lies close by to the south. The fishing village is the oldest surviving cannery on the west coast of Canada. Self guided tours explore the bunk houses, the belt driven machinery in the main cannery building, the management cabins and an old cannery store. inchanga steam railway
